Syep Intake Coordinator - Queens, United States - Police Athletic League Inc
Description
The Police Athletic League (PAL) is the largest independent youth organization in New York City that provides educational and recreational activities for children and young adults.
PAL Inc.and The New York City Police Department work in partnership to provide communities with summer and after-school recreational and educational activities.
We are looking for
part-time seasonal SYEP Intake Coordinators who will be responsible for the pre-monitoring of all prospective worksites and completing all necessary pre-monitoring reports.
The position is available at the Youth Employment Department - Edward Byrne Center - Queens
Must be willing to travel throughout NYC 5 Boroughs
Major Duties & Responsibilities:
- Model and uphold all Agency rules.
- Must be willing to travel within NYC's 5 boroughs.
- Assist with the worksite development process as need.
- Assist with the SYEP job placement as needed.
- Assist with the maintenance of program files as needed.
- Enter monitoring reports into the DYCD YEPS system.
- Create and submit program related reports (excel and word documents) as requested.
- Work collaboratively and professionally with a varied group of colleagues.
- Perform other job-related duties as assigned.
Pay Rate:
$19.00 Per Hour Up to 30 Hours Per Week
Skills/Knowledge Required:
- Strong communication skills.
- Experience working in an office environment, with prior data entry experience preferred.
- Demonstrated knowledge of Microsoft Office and Google.
- Ability to work independently and in a group.
